The BLS Certification course offered by CPR Cart is an American Heart Association–aligned training program designed for healthcare providers who need fast, reliable Basic Life Support certification or renewal. The course uses a convenient hybrid learning format, allowing students to complete the HeartCode® online training at their own pace and then finish a short in-person skills session using an automated CPR Cart station. After successfully demonstrating CPR techniques, AED use, airway management, and emergency response skills, participants receive an official AHA BLS Provider eCard accepted nationwide by employers. The program focuses on real-world clinical skills, flexible 24/7 scheduling, and hands-on practice that can typically be completed in about 30 minutes, making certification efficient without requiring a full classroom day.

The ACLS Certification course from CPR Cart is an American Heart Association–approved training program designed for healthcare professionals who manage cardiac emergencies and critical patient care. The course follows a blended learning format, allowing students to complete the HeartCode® ACLS online training at home and then schedule a short hands-on skills session at a CPR Cart automated training station. During the course, participants learn advanced cardiac arrest management, ECG rhythm recognition, airway management, pharmacology, stroke and acute coronary syndrome treatment, and team-based resuscitation techniques. The skills verification typically takes about 30 minutes and provides real-time feedback using RQI manikin technology. After successfully completing both portions, students instantly receive their official American Heart Association ACLS Provider eCard, making certification fast, flexible, and nationally recognized for healthcare professionals.

The PALS Certification course at CPR Cart is an American Heart Association–approved training program designed for healthcare professionals who care for infants and children during medical emergencies. The course follows a convenient two-step hybrid format, allowing students to complete the self-paced online HeartCode PALS training first and then schedule a short in-person skills check at a CPR Cart automated station. Participants learn pediatric assessment, respiratory and cardiac emergency management, shock treatment, team dynamics, medication administration, and post-cardiac arrest care. Hands-on skills validation typically takes about 30 minutes, and students receive their official AHA PALS Provider eCard immediately after successful completion, making certification fast, flexible, and ideal for busy healthcare providers.
